vivo T4 announced with Snapdragon 7s Gen 3 and 7,300mAh battery
The vivo T4 made its debut in India today as the newest entry in the brand’s T-series. It brings a massive 7,300mAh battery with 90W charging, Qualcomm Snapdragon 7s Gen 3 chipset and up to 12GB RAM.
With its 7,300mAh cell, the vivo T4 is one of the best-equipped phones in its class. It comes in at 7.89mm thick and weighs 199 grams.
The battery features third-generation silicon-carbon anode technology and supports bypass charging. Like the vivo Y300 Pro+ and iQOO Z10, vivo T4 supports reverse OTG charging capabilities with charging speeds of up to 7.5W.
The phone is IP65 dust and water resistant as well as MIL-STD-810H compliant.
You get a 6.77-inch curved AMOLED display with FHD+ resolution and a 120Hz refresh rate. The panel is rated at 5,000 nits local peak brightness, and it features a 32MP front-facing camera and an optical under-display fingerprint scanner.
The back houses a 50 MP main cam (IMX882) and a 2MP depth sensor. The software side is covered by Funtouch OS 15 based on Android 15 with a guaranteed 2 Android OS updates and 3 years of security updates.
vivo T4 comes in Emerald Blaze and Phantom Grey colors. Pricing starts at INR 21,999 ($258) for the 8/256GB trim and goes up to INR 25,999 ($305) for the 12/256GB trim. Pre-orders are now live, while official sales will start on April 29.
